Description du poste

  1. Event Planning and Organization:

    • Assist in planning and organizing meetings, retreats, and events.
    • Contribute to the development of presentations, including drafting PowerPoint presentations for quarterly town hall meetings.
    • Facilitate team-building activities and events as required.
    • Provide support in the recruitment process for consultants, ensuring alignment with budgetary constraints.
  2. Document Management and Reporting:

    • Manage SharePoint to ensure timely filing of reports and documents, supporting audit readiness.
    • Organize key documents and maintain visibility within the SharePoint platform.
    • Regularly review and adjust SharePoint organization as necessary.
  3. Procurement Support:

    • Assist in the procurement process by creating and updating supplier profiles in Fusion.
    • Coordinate the circulation of memos for signature and create requisitions as needed.
    • Provide support to suppliers, including assistance with iSupplier and invoice payments.
    • Maintain supplier performance database and act as a liaison with the Sourcing department.
  4. Office Management:

    • Manage communication from the Strategic Initiatives email address and update distribution lists accordingly.
  5. Travel Coordination:

    • Coordinate travel arrangements for both online and offline consultants as requested.
    • Provide travel support for participants attending organization events.

Description du profil

  • Bachelor's degree in a relevant field or equivalent work experience.
  • Proven experience in project coordination or administrative roles.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ines effectively.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and SharePoint.
